Originally Posted by acg
Here is an link that I saved for reference a few years ago from this forum:
http://www.discotd5.com/ecu-upgrades...e-facelift-d2s

This is my understanding....

1) SRD000070 was fitted to pre-2002 vehicles
2) SRD000150 which was fitted to 2003 and 2004 vehicles
3) SRD500070 was offered to support a recall campaign A/B/D 263

The SRD500070 unicorn does exist from the pic below. Note it came with a 12/06 manufacture date which could explain its use to support the recall campaign even after Disco 2 production ceased. And also perhaps explain why wreckyard aspirations on 2004 Discos for the illusive SRD500070 have not been successful.
That is very, very interesting information. That means people may be able to check for the recall with the VIN without tearing into the truck to remove the SLABS.

That said, we still don't know the differences are with the SRD500070.

Originally Posted by mln01
That is very, very interesting information. That means people may be able to check for the recall with the VIN without tearing into the truck to remove the SLABS.
LR owners of older models can register into JLR's Topix site and may be able get this info for free:

https://topix.jaguar.jlrext.com/topi...cle/lookupForm

Register for an account with them. Verify your email. Then use "Independent Operator Login".

Once registered, lots of info will come up after entering the vehicle's VIN.
